More about Patio de Piedra Hotel Boutique

Patio de Piedra Hotel Boutique

Located 200 metres from San Francisco square, Patio de Piedra Hotel Boutique offers accommodations in La Paz. Free Wi-Fi access is available in every room. Patio de Piedra Hotel Boutique is built in a colonial house with carved wooden walls.

Good location, but not in the main tourist area

Our taxi pulled up alongside shuttered doors at 6am in the deserted street.
Suddenly the doors swung open, and without a word a man appeared, grabbed our two suitcases in each hand and proceeded upstairs to the reception. 5 minutes later we were getting comfortable in our room on the third floor. The wonderful service continued during out 4 day stay. When we complained about the altitude the same man offered us oxygen which he allowed us to take to our room. Our bus to Copacabana was leaving at 6.30am, so he offered us a packed breakfast for the road.
Our room was quite large with a big wardrobe, a fridge and 2 double beds. We were situated on the third floor. The hotel has no elevator and I found the stairs difficult, although the oxygen certainly helped.
The location is not in the main tourist area, but if you want to experience authentic Bolivia, it's all happening just around the corner, a few minutes walk. Alternatively, it's 10-15 minutes walk to Sagarnaga Street, which is the main tourist area where you will find lots of hotels, hostels, cafes, restos, handcraft shops and travel agents.

Important information about the city

Bolivian citizens will be charged an additional 13% value added tax. Please note that foreign guests do not need to pay this tax if they show their passports, immigration cards (issued within the past 90 days), and a non-Bolivian credit card.
